Merge commit 'e6faf1b0efa08d8b88cc42c2d35339dcd4fa65d1'
diff --git a/ForgeDiscussion/forgediscussion/model/forum.py b/ForgeDiscussion/forgediscussion/model/forum.py
index bab3edf..f0e90c0 100644
--- a/ForgeDiscussion/forgediscussion/model/forum.py
+++ b/ForgeDiscussion/forgediscussion/model/forum.py
@@ -215,6 +215,11 @@
history_class = ForumPostHistory
indexes = [
'timestamp', # for the posts_24hr site_stats query
+ ( # for last_post queries on thread listing page
+ 'thread_id',
+ 'deleted',
+ ('timestamp', pymongo.DESCENDING),
+ ),
]
type_s = 'Post'
@@ -245,4 +250,5 @@
polymorphic_identity = 'ForumAttachment'
attachment_type = FieldProperty(str, if_missing='ForumAttachment')
+
Mapper.compile_all()